'I take no interest in their private lives'

In the early summer of 1933, Hitler reportedly told Hermann Rauschning, who would later break from the Nazi Party
I won't spoil any of my men's fun. If I demand the utmost of them, I must also leave them free to let off steam as they want, not as churchy old women think fit ... I take no interest in their private lives, just as I won't stand for people prying into my own.
